Understanding of lab procedure and safety training is desired too. Each time blood is taken as a sample, care must be given to how this is done and how the equipment is disposed of. An accident with a needle or with the labeling of samples can have dreadful results. This is often either to the phlebotomist or the patient. Within the rapidly growing healthcare sector, employment of clinical laboratory technicians (which comprises phlebotomists) is anticipated to increase 14 percent from 2006 to 2016--quicker than the average for all occupations. The increase in new jobs is due to rising population and also the development of new lab evaluations.
